Gangi noted that modern agricultural production in the country is developing in accordance with international standards, sustainable technologies are being introduced, and food security is being strengthened.
Innovative approaches are already yielding tangible results in Azerbaijan's agriculture, FAO Deputy Regional Representative for Europe and Central Asia Nabil Gangi said at the 4th Agribusiness Development Forum held in Baku, EDnews informs.
"Best agricultural practices are applied in accordance with international standards, ensuring safe, sustainable and environmentally friendly food production. Modern technologies are actively introduced to boost productivity and efficiency. The expansion of sustainable irrigation systems also helps to conserve resources in the face of climate stress," he said.
According to the FAO official, various initiatives of Azerbaijan within the framework of COP29 have strengthened the importance of sustainable development and the role of innovation in the agricultural sector.
